How I got started

I got started riding motorcycles through a friend. I began with a 1980 Honda CB750C which I rode for a year. Then I moved up to a 2002 Honda Interceptor where I really got into sport-touring. It was with this Honda I first went to the track and from there I was hooked. I`ve spent the last couple of years progressively doing more and more track days until 2006 when I started to racing.

Competitive Highlights

Completed every novice heat in WMRRA since the start of the year finishing mid-pack in every race.
Graduted Novice after 12 heats
Improved lap times from the beginning of the season at Pacific Raceways from 1:55`s to 1:43.3
